To set VLAN ID and priority for LAN Port (Port 0):
9

Press LAN Port VLAN..

10

Press LAN Port VLAN ID and then enter a value from 1 to 4094 to specify the VLAN ID for the LAN
Port. Default is 1.

11

Press SIP Priority and then enter a value from 0 to 7 to specify the SIP priority for the LAN Port.
Default is 3.

12

Press RTP Priority and then enter a value from 0 to 7 to specify the RTP priority for the LAN Port.
Default is 5.

13

Press RTCP Priority and then enter a value from 0 to 7 to specify the RTCP priority for the LAN Port.
Default is 5.

To set VLAN ID and priority for PC Port (Port 1):
15

Press PC Port VLAN..

16

Note: Press PC Port VLAN ID and then enter a value from 1 to 4095 for the PC Port VLAN ID.
Default is 4095. If you set the PC Port VLAN ID (Port 1) to 4095, all untagged packets are sent to this
port. The following is an example of configuring the phone on a VLAN where all untagged packets
are sent to the PC Port (passthrough port).

Example
You enable tagging on the phone port as normal but set the passthrough port (PC Port) to
4095. The following example sets the phone to be on VLAN 3 but the passthrough port is
configured as untagged.

VLAN Settings->VLAN Enable: Yes

VLAN Settings->Phone VLAN->Phone VLAN ID: 3

VLAN Settings->PC Port VLAN->PC Port VLAN ID: 4095

17

Press Priority and then enter a value from 0 to 7 to specify the PC Port VLAN priority. Default is 0.

To globally enable/disable VLAN and set priority for non-IP packets:
18

On the Network screen, press the Ethernet & VLAN button.

19

Press VLAN Settings.

20

Press LAN Port VLAN.

21

Press Other Priority and enter a value from 0 to 7 to specify the global setting for the LAN port. This
value is also applicable to non-IP packets. Default is 5.
